Output c38ae98475d80fd5f5dfbf8e4f1aca477efcdecafdd53b3ad8ac6dba7687d93c:0

value
84850723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66314028829727b8ed7d9381e6d758414aa669a9 OP_EQUAL
address
3B1Mr6x5W3EkcaTAgmNJ73dTLu2UNJWmxp
transaction
c38ae98475d80fd5f5dfbf8e4f1aca477efcdecafdd53b3ad8ac6dba7687d93c
confirmations
340525
spent
true